WebOct 13, 2024 · Direct rule is a system of governmental rule in which the central authority has power over the country. Indirect rule is a system of government in which a central … WebDirect rule is the current practice nearly everywhere throughout the world. Indirect rule is being attempted in only a few places. One of those few places is British West Africa -- the composite designation for Nigeria, Gold Coast, Sierra Leone, the Gambia and the British mandated areas in Cameroons and Togoland. shutdown -t

WebThe goal of indirect rule was to develop future leaders, while the goal of direct rule was assimilation, or integration of the native population into European culture and traditions. WebIndirect rule was a system of governance used by the British and others to control parts of their colonial empires, particularly in Africa and Asia, which was done through pre-existing indigenous power structures.
